Direct Support Professionals (DSP) cares for individuals experiencing developmental or intellectual disabilities. Their main duties include helping Individuals complete basic housekeeping tasks, transporting individuals to appointments or other social outings and keeping individuals safe from potential health hazards in their surrounding environment, following behavior plans, teaching self-care skills, cooking meals and doing laundry.
Additional duties may include:
Assisting clients with daily personal tasks, including bathing and dressing
Completing housekeeping tasks such as vacuuming, washing dishes and tidying
Helping plan client appointments and organizing a schedule
Organizing transportation arrangements to appointments
Shopping for groceries and preparing meals that meet specific client dietary needs
Encouraging client engagement in social networks and communities
